Job Title: Compartment Completion Specialist

At our organization, we strive to make a meaningful impact in our work. Our team is passionate about delivering innovative solutions that push boundaries and drive success.

Opportunity

We are seeking a highly skilled Compartment Completion Specialist to join our team based at the SA-Osborne Naval Shipyard, reporting directly to the Compartment Completion Manager. As a key member of our team, you will play a crucial role in the progressive completion and delivery of our programs to our customers.

Key Responsibilities:
  • Conduct comprehensive compartment and tank inspections, documenting identified issues and analyzing emerging trends.
  • Support the Compartment Completion Manager to maintain the compartment completion schedule.
  • Organize inspection activities with multiple stakeholders, developing strong relationships with customer representatives.
  • Support Area Managers for the management and deconfliction of activities in accordance with the Ship Plan of Day (SPOD).
  • Support the management of safety, quality, trade resourcing, risk, and opportunities for the compartment completion scope.
  • Ensure effective communication is maintained with Safety, Health, and Environment (SHE) Advisors.
  • Maintain comprehensive records of compartment completion progress, ensuring all inspections and documentation are in place and up to date.
About You

To be successful in this role, you will need:

  • A degree or trade qualification with experience relevant to shipbuilding.
  • Knowledge and demonstrated experience in inspection in relevant shipbuilding disciplines.
  • A confined space certificate or the ability to obtain one.
  • Proactive and detail-oriented skills.
  • The ability to work independently and manage multiple tasks.
  • Strong background in conducting inspections with inspection qualification highly desirable.
  • Excellent communication skills both written and verbal to communicate effectively across multiple levels of the business.
  • Proficiency in using Microsoft Office and ability to learn relevant software packages used on HCF.
  • Eligibility to be cleared for International Traffic In Arms (ITAR) regulations.
